Piezocrystal Constrained Gyro Development Program,
Abstract
A new concept in mechanizing a gyro for strapdown applications has been conceived and demonstrated. The key to this development is pressure sensitive crystals which are mounted in such a manner as to constrain any motion about the gyro's output axis. This report deals with the analysis and experimental results obtained on an initial breadboard model. The gyro was not evaluated against a particular set of requirements but, rather, it was examined as a general solution to strapdown applications. The results of this investigation indicate that the constrained gyro is a highly feasible technique for all strapdown applications. It provides a digital output directly from the sensor without the need of analog to digital converters or precision torquers. Several design weaknesses were uncovered, as well as the outstanding good system results. (Author)
